When you uninstall Windows Server 2003 from your computer, then it means that the system will loose all the data that you had stored in the server, and therefore you might want to make a backup first.

The windows operating system that your computer will revert to will be the one that you will be installing during the formatting of the computer. For instance, if you are using a windows XP CD to format the computer so as to install windows XP and get rid of Windows Server 2003, then it is windows XP that will be on your computer after you finish the formatting process. The same case is true for the other windows versions.
